Borlabs Cookie: The Strict Script Blocker
When you function within the DACH area (Germany, Austria, Switzerland), you recognize the authorized requirements are brutal. Borlabs Cookie was engineered particularly to deal with strict European telecommunications legal guidelines just like the TTDSG. It doesn’t fiddle.
Most plugins attempt to block scripts gracefully. Borlabs makes use of a brute-force method. It intercepts and blocks exterior iFrames like YouTube movies, Google Maps, and social feeds completely. Customers see a placeholder till they explicitly click on to just accept the cookies for that particular component.
It shops all consent knowledge regionally. There aren’t any exterior cloud calls to third-party servers. This makes it a favourite amongst privateness purists.

Cookiebot by Usercentrics: The Automated Scanner
Cookiebot excels at large-scale discovery. While you’ve an enterprise web site with tons of of pages and legacy advertising and marketing tags hidden in every single place, discovering all of your cookies manually is unattainable. Cookiebot fixes this with deep-scan expertise.
It acts like a search engine crawler. It spiders your whole web site, executes all of the JavaScript, and paperwork each single cookie it finds. It then matches these in opposition to its huge world database to robotically categorize them into Vital, Preferences, Statistics, and Advertising.
This degree of automation comes at a worth. And actually, it may be overkill for a small weblog. However for company websites, it’s a large time saver.

How one can Take a look at Your Cookie Banner Set up
You may’t simply set up a banner and assume it really works. Damaged banners are a large legal responsibility. In case your advertising and marketing tags fireplace earlier than the person clicks settle for, you aren’t compliant. You’re simply annoying your guests for no authorized profit.
Testing requires diving into your browser’s developer instruments. It’s a fast course of as soon as you recognize what to search for. You’ll have to clear your native storage to simulate a brand-new customer hitting your web site.
Observe these steps to confirm your set up is definitely blocking scripts:
- Open your web site in an Incognito window or clear your browser cache completely.
- Proper-click and choose Examine to open Chrome DevTools.
- Navigate to the Community tab and refresh the web page.
- Kind “analytics” or “gtm” into the filter bar. When you see Google Analytics firing earlier than you click on settle for in your banner, your set up failed.
- Click on “Settle for All” in your banner. Watch the Community tab to make sure these particular scripts now set off instantly.

Steadily Requested Questions
Do I want a cookie banner if I don’t run advertisements?
Sure. Even in the event you don’t run advertisements, you probably use primary analytics instruments or embed YouTube movies. These third-party companies set monitoring cookies, which legally require person consent below GDPR laws.
What occurs if I ignore Google Consent Mode v2?
When you promote to customers within the EEA/UK and don’t implement GCM v2, Google will block your skill to construct remarketing audiences. Your conversion monitoring accuracy will plummet, destroying your advert marketing campaign ROI.
Can I take advantage of a free plugin for strict GDPR compliance?
It’s dangerous. Most free plugins solely show a discover message. They don’t really block scripts from firing previous to consent, which is a tough requirement for precise GDPR compliance.

What’s International Privateness Management (GPC)?
GPC is a browser-level sign that tells web sites the person doesn’t need their knowledge offered or tracked. By 2026, many US state legal guidelines require your web site to detect and honor this sign robotically.
How usually ought to I scan my web site for brand new cookies?
It’s best to scan your web site everytime you add a brand new plugin or monitoring pixel. When you use automated instruments, a month-to-month scan is the business commonplace for catching unauthorized third-party trackers.
Are cookie partitions authorized?
No. A “cookie wall” forces customers to just accept monitoring earlier than they’ll learn your content material. European knowledge safety boards have explicitly dominated that consent have to be freely given, making partitions unlawful.
What’s the distinction between CCPA and GDPR banners?
GDPR requires an “opt-in” method the place trackers are blocked till the person says sure. The CCPA makes use of an “opt-out” method, permitting monitoring by default however requiring a visual “Do Not Promote My Information” hyperlink.
